ML identifies discrepancies in 40 years of nuclear data

bravo_abad · x · 2026-08-28

Researchers used a sparse Bayesian model to analyze 21 measurements of the prompt neutron spectrum from californium-252 fission spanning four decades. By encoding 41 experimental details, the ML identified features most associated with discrepancies. Physicists then used these clues to run simulations and new experiments, correcting or rejecting historical data and significantly reducing the spread in measurements.
